Before we dive into the pricing details, it is essential to understand what solar energy storage systems are. These systems are designed to store excess energy generated by solar panels for use when the sun isn't shining—particularly at night or during cloudy days. By incorporating a storage solution, you can maximize the utility of your solar energy system, reduce reliance on the grid, and ultimately save on electricity costs.

As of 2023, the prices for solar energy storage batteries have been declining, which can be attributed to advancements in technology and increased competition in the market. Below is a general price range you can expect:
| Battery Type | Price per kWh | Lifecycle (in years) |
|---|---|---|
| Lithium-Ion | $500 - $2000 | 10 - 15 |
| Lead-Acid | $150 - $800 | 3 - 7 |
| Saltwater | $1000 - $4000 | 10+ |

One significant factor that can offset the cost of solar energy storage systems is the variety of financial incentives and rebates available. These can include federal tax credits, state incentives, and even rebates from local utilities aiming to promote energy storage. It is crucial to research available options in your area, as these incentives can reduce your overall expenditure by thousands of dollars.
As we look to the future, experts predict that the prices of solar batteries will continue to decline as technology improves and production scales up. The integration of artificial intelligence and smart technology is likely to enhance the efficiency and effectiveness of storage systems, potentially paving the way for even lower prices. Furthermore, the push towards sustainability will increasingly drive consumer demand, stimulating competition among manufacturers and ultimately benefiting the consumer.
